Originally Posted by leftlane
Leasing a pre-owned car (much less one that is a prior body style and almost 5 years old already) is a horrible idea.
It depends on what residual value will be, AND if you'll want to keep it past the end of the lease.

I'm almost never a proponent of leasing, but sometimes they get the residual wrong- especially on new vehicles where the mfg is underwriting the least end residual. They'll try to keep it high to move more new cars. The E60 M5 is a great example.
